Amundi Purchases 100,740 Shares of STERIS plc (NYSE:STE)

Amundi increased its holdings in shares of STERIS plc (NYSE:STEFree Report) by 28.1%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 459,066 shares of the medical equipment provider’s stock after buying an additional 100,740 shares during the quarter. Amundi owned 0.47% of STERIS worth $96,142,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

About STERIS

(Free Report)

STERIS plc provides infection prevention products and services worldwide. It operates through four segments: Healthcare, Applied Sterilization Technologies, Life Sciences, and Dental. The Healthcare segment offers cleaning chemistries and sterility assurance products; automated endoscope reprocessing system and tracking products; endoscopy accessories, washers, sterilizers, and other pieces of capital equipment for the operation of a sterile processing department; and equipment used directly in the operating room, including surgical tables, lights, and connectivity solutions, as well as equipment management services.
